    Summary of reviews

    Anastasia - Home Care for the Elderly, Board Care presents a mixed but generally positive picture. Many families and residents praised the staff’s compassion, professionalism, and hands-on leadership; reviewers consistently describe a clean, home-like environment with comfortable, spacious rooms. The facility’s onsite occupational and physical therapy services receive strong positive comments, with tangible rehabilitation outcomes reported — several residents regained mobility and were supported in transitions back to independent living. Management presence and staff education were highlighted as strengths, and social programming and varied activities contributed to a reassuring atmosphere for many residents.

    Clinical-care reports are mixed. While many reviewers experienced attentive nursing and effective therapy, others described lapses in clinical oversight, including inconsistent nurse visit frequency and uneven medication administration or refill handling. There is at least one serious account of a catheter complication that resulted in internal injury and a subsequent transfer to another facility; this individual claim underscores the need for families to review clinical protocols and incident response procedures during intake and discharge planning. Related operational issues include medication supply continuity problems and occasional needs for additional training on medical equipment such as oxygen delivery systems.

    Operational and administrative issues also appear as recurring themes. Communication gaps were noted around discharge processes and medical-billing follow-through, and some reviewers reported difficulties obtaining post-discharge documents. Night-shift staffing levels were called out as insufficient in a few accounts, which may affect responsiveness during evening hours. Environmental-safety maintenance gaps were mentioned (for example, nonfunctional call systems and unsecured electrical outlets/cables), suggesting the facility should be evaluated closely for maintenance practices and routine safety checks.

    Dining and social programming receive largely favorable comments — many reviewers praised home-cooked, diet-tailored meals and an engaging social environment — though a minority described limited or inconsistent meal quality. Prospective residents and families should assess meal variety and special-diet accommodations during a visit. Overall, the facility shows clear strengths in staff compassion, cleanliness, rehabilitation services, and leadership engagement, but there are identifiable operational weaknesses around medication management, clinical oversight, safety maintenance, and administrative follow-through. Visitors should observe staffing patterns (including nights), review medication and equipment protocols, and clarify discharge and billing procedures before admission.

    No, Anastasia - Home Care for the Elderly, Board Care does not offer respite care. Respite care in assisted living communities provides temporary, short-term relief for primary caregivers by offering professional care for their loved ones. It allows individuals to stay in an assisted living community for a limited time, giving caregivers a break while ensuring residents receive necessary support and assistance with daily activities.

    Safety & Compliance

    In California, the Department of Social Services' Community Care Licensing Division licenses residential care facilities for the elderly, conducting inspections and investigating complaints.

    28 May 2025Inspection
    Found no deficiencies cited. Safety and care measures appeared to be properly implemented.
    26 Sept 2024Inspection
    Identified that a staff member was not fingerprint-cleared and could not interact with residents until clearance was obtained.
    • Type A87411(g)(1)
    26 Sept 2024Complaint
    Investigated an allegation that a resident was not adequately fed and that staff did not assist transferring out of bed. Investigators found insufficient evidence to prove the allegations.
    16 Jul 2024Complaint
    Found that staff lacked fingerprint clearance and that unqualified staff administered medications.
    • Type A87411(g)(1)
    • Type A1569.629(a)(2)
    • Type A1569.69
    19 Jun 2024Inspection
    Identified lapses in medication management and staff records, including unlocked medications, missing PRN MARs, incomplete resident files, and lack of hospice training records.
    • Type ACCR87465(h)(2)
    • Type ACCR87465(c)(2)
    • Type BCCR87633(f)(1)
    • Type BCCR87412(g)
    • Type BCCR87465(h)(2)
    • Type BCCR87465(c)(3)
    23 Jun 2023Inspection
    Identified deficiencies in resident reappraisals and in MAR documentation for PRN medications; observed full bed rails used for a non-hospice resident.
    • Type A87608(a)(5)(B)
    • Type B87463(a)
    • Type B87465(d)(3)
    26 Sept 2022Inspection
    Identified safety deficiencies, including unlocked cleaning supplies accessible to residents and a staff member lacking a required health screening.
    • Type A87309(a)
    • Type B87411(f)
    09 Jun 2022Inspection
    Observed readiness for licensure after addressing safety features, security measures, and yard changes. No issues noted that would prevent licensure.
    13 May 2022Inspection
    Observed a face-to-face Component III presentation with the licensee/administrator and discussion of regulations governing operation.
    13 May 2022Inspection
    Identified several safety and accessibility concerns that needed correction before licensure, including the fire extinguisher's servicing status, a locked perimeter gate, absence of carbon monoxide detectors, missing grab bars in the hallway bathroom, improperly installed door hardware, and clutter in the backyard.
    29 Apr 2022Inspection
    Identified that COMP II for pre-licensing was successfully completed via teleconference with the applicant and administrator, and their understanding of licensing requirements was confirmed.
